You should start to choose the poet for your special presentation.

November 1st Thursday

student led classes: each student will choose an author and poem to present. We'll try to stick to a schedule of 4 poems/students per class.

Suggested poets include: *Toru Dutt, *Alice Meynell, Edith Nesbit, *Mary Coleridge, Jean Ingelow, May Kendall, George Eliot, *Emily Bronte, Charlotte Bronte, Dora Greenwell, Violet Fane, Mathilde Blind, Emily Pfeiffer, Agnes Robinson, Dollie Radford.

Others may be found in Victorian Women Poets, ed. Leighton and Reynolds, and Nineteenth-Century Women Poets, ed. Armstrong and Bristow.
